The economy does not move like one tidy average. The 80/20 rule is a quick reminder that a small part of a system often explains a large part of the result, and in economics that small part might be asset owners, exporters, metro areas, banks, or shipping chokepoints. If you only watch the headline number - GDP growth, inflation, unemployment - you can miss the few places where power, risk, and opportunity are actually concentrated.

This article uses the 80/20 lens to read those concentrations. You will see why wealth is more concentrated than income, how a tiny share of exporting firms can create most export value, why a minority of metro areas produces most U.S. output, and why regulators watch a short list of banks so closely. None of these ratios is magic. They are clues: find the vital few first, then decide whether the smart move is to support the engine, widen access, or build protection around a chokepoint.

Why Wealth Is More Concentrated Than Income

Income and wealth are often discussed together, but they behave differently. Income is a flow: wages, business profits, dividends, rent, interest. Wealth is a stock: houses, shares, bonds, businesses, land, retirement accounts, and debt netted out. Wealth concentrates faster because assets earn returns, rise in price, and can be inherited. The World Inequality Report 2022 estimated that the top 10% of adults receive about 52% of global income, while owning about 76% of global wealth. That is the cleanest economic “aha” in this topic: inequality is not just about paychecks. It is about who owns the machines, code, property, brands, and financial assets that keep producing income after the workday ends.

In the United States, Federal Reserve distributional data tells a similar story. Around 2022, the top 10% of families held roughly two-thirds of household wealth, while the bottom half held only a small single-digit share. The exact figure moves with asset prices, but the pattern is stable enough to shape housing, retirement, campaign finance, and consumption.

80/20 example: The World Inequality Report 2022 put the global top 10% at roughly 76% of wealth ownership. That is not exactly 20/80, but it is close enough to show the same mechanism: a minority of asset owners controls most balance-sheet power.

8020 move: When judging an economy, look at wealth shares alongside GDP per person. Start with top 10%, middle 40%, and bottom 50% wealth shares before forming an opinion about fairness or stability. 80/20 Rule Example: The Top 1% of Exporters

The “average business” is a poor guide to how modern economies grow. Most firms are small, local, and not especially productive. A much smaller set sells across borders, invests heavily in technology, hires specialized workers, and builds supply chains that smaller firms cannot easily copy. Economists Andrew Bernard, J. Bradford Jensen, Stephen Redding, and Peter Schott, using U.S. firm-level trade data, showed how extreme export concentration can be. In U.S. data around 2000, the top 1% of exporting firms accounted for roughly 80% of U.S. export value. That is a striking version of the 80/20 pattern, and it is not because the other 99% are useless.

Exporting has fixed costs: compliance, logistics, foreign distribution, financing, language, legal risk, and customer support across time zones. Scale helps: a large firm can spread regulatory and logistics costs over many units. Intangibles compound: software, patents, brands, and data get more valuable when used across many markets. Networks reinforce winners: suppliers, distributors, and skilled workers cluster around firms that already have demand.

80/20 example: In U.S. exporter research, about 1% of exporters generated around 80% of export value. The vital few were not just bigger versions of normal firms; they operated with different capabilities.

8020 move: A founder should ask which capability could move the company from local seller to scalable exporter: certification, distribution, enterprise sales, or a repeatable production process. A policymaker should not spread every support program evenly across all firms. Some money should improve broad basics, but growth policy also needs to identify the firms and sectors with realistic export or productivity potential. Largest Metro Areas and Their Share of U.S. GDP

People sometimes talk as if jobs can be moved anywhere once there is broadband. Some can. Many cannot, because cities create what economists call agglomeration economies: deep labor markets, nearby suppliers, faster knowledge spillovers, better matching between specialized workers and firms, and more chances for accidental learning. Brookings research has repeatedly noted that the 100 largest U.S. metropolitan areas contain about two-thirds of the population and produce roughly three-quarters of U.S. GDP. That is not a perfect 20/80 split, but it shows the direction clearly: national growth is heavily shaped by a minority of places.

There is a catch. When productive cities restrict housing too tightly, the gains get trapped in land prices and rents. The city still looks rich, but new workers cannot move in easily, and lower-income residents get pushed outward. A high-output region can become both an engine and a bottleneck.

80/20 example: In the United States, roughly 100 large metro areas produce about 75% of GDP while holding about 66% of the population. A minority of places drives a majority of measured output.

8020 move: Do not compare “the economy” only at the national level. Pull up job growth, wage growth, housing costs, and business formation for your city or region. For career choices, this reveals whether your best move is relocation, remote access to a stronger labor market, or building a niche where you already live.

Systemically Important Banks and Concentration Risk

Financial systems look broad because they contain thousands of banks, funds, insurers, payment companies, and markets. But crises often travel through chokepoints: highly connected banks, short-term funding markets, large clearing houses, government bond markets, or a commodity price that sits underneath many contracts. The Financial Stability Board’s global systemically important bank list usually contains fewer than 35 banks. That is tiny compared with the number of banks in the world, yet regulators pay special attention to them because their failure could transmit stress across borders.

The mechanism is not mysterious: leverage magnifies losses, maturity mismatch turns small doubts into funding runs, and interbank connections spread fear faster than balance sheets can be checked. The 2008 crisis made this concrete. Lehman Brothers was one institution, but its bankruptcy hit money market funds, derivatives counterparties, repo funding, confidence in other investment banks, and the real economy. The lesson was not “one firm caused everything.” It was that a few nodes sat in places where losses could cascade.

80/20 example: Fewer than three dozen banks can receive global systemic importance labels in a world with thousands of banks. A very small share of institutions can account for a large share of financial-system attention because connectivity matters as much as size.

8020 move: Map your top three financial exposures: employer, mortgage or rent, investment portfolio, business customers, or debt rate. Then ask what happens if interest rates, energy prices, or one major counterparty moves against you. The Best Economic Questions Look for the Binding Constraint

The 80/20 view should not become an excuse to worship winners or ignore everyone else. The real value is diagnostic. If a few households hold most assets, the lever might be tax design, housing access, retirement saving, inheritance rules, or broad asset ownership. If a few firms drive exports, the lever might be competition policy, infrastructure, skills, or financing for firms just below the frontier. If a few cities drive growth, the answer is not simply “fund the winners.” It might be better rail links, looser housing rules, university commercialization, or digital infrastructure that lets smaller regions connect to larger markets. If a few banks or markets carry systemic risk, the answer is targeted capital buffers, stress tests, liquidity rules, and credible resolution plans.

A simple way to use this today is to make a four-line concentration map: Households: Who owns the assets, and who depends mostly on wages? Firms: Which companies create most exports, jobs, profits, or R&D? Places: Which cities or regions are pulling ahead, and why? Risks: Which institutions, prices, or markets could spread trouble fastest? That map is more useful than a single headline GDP number. GDP growth can look healthy while household balance sheets weaken, regional gaps widen, or financial risk builds quietly in one corner.

Read the Economy by Its Concentrations

The economy is shaped by averages, but it is often explained by concentrations. Wealth is more concentrated than income. Export power sits inside a small group of capable firms. Output clusters in major metro areas. Financial danger collects around a few connected nodes. That does not mean the same people, firms, or cities should always get more attention. It means serious analysis starts by locating the vital few and then asking what to do about them. Sometimes the right move is to support the engine. Sometimes it is to tax the rent. Sometimes it is to open access. Sometimes it is to build buffers around the chokepoint before it breaks. The 80/20 habit in economics is simple: before arguing about policy, investing, career moves, or business strategy, find the distribution. The leverage is usually hiding in the part of the chart that the average has smoothed away.
